Employing expected value calculations to choose advantageous bets
Expected value (EV) represents the average amount a player can expect to win or lose from a bet over the long term. It is calculated as:
| EV | = (Probability of Win × Net Profit) + (Probability of Loss × Net Loss) |
|---|---|
| Positive EV | Indicates a profitable bet in the long run |
| Negative EV | Likely to lead to losses over time |
For example, in blackjack, a player can calculate the EV of hitting or standing based on card counting data. If the EV of hitting exceeds that of standing, the player should choose that option. Similarly, in sports betting, analyzing the probability of an outcome against bookmaker odds allows identifying bets with positive EV, thereby increasing profitability.
Utilizing variance and risk assessment for better bankroll management
While EV indicates the average expected outcome, variance measures the fluctuations around that average, informing players about risk levels. High variance strategies might offer substantial short-term gains but can also lead to significant losses. Consequently, integrating variance analysis helps in designing bankroll management plans—such as setting maximum bet sizes or stop-loss limits—to mitigate risk and sustain long-term playability.
